Understanding the Challenges of Drainage on Marco Island
Marco Island, situated in Collier County, Florida, is a beautiful tropical destination known for its stunning beaches and lush vegetation. However, the island's subtropical climate and sandy soil create unique challenges when it comes to managing rainwater runoff and ensuring effective drainage. With an average annual rainfall of over 60 inches, Marco Island residents must be proactive in designing their yards with eco-friendly drainage solutions.
The Impact of Heavy Rainfall on Your Yard
June to September is the peak monsoon season in Florida, which means heavy downpours are a common occurrence on Marco Island. Excessive rainwater can cause:
- Waterlogged soil, leading to erosion and damage to plants
- Flooded walkways and patios, creating slippery surfaces
- Increased risk of pest infestations, such as mosquitoes and rodents
Eco-Friendly Drainage Solutions for Your Yard
Fortunately, there are many eco-friendly drainage solutions that can help you manage rainwater runoff on Marco Island. Here are some effective options to consider:
Rain Barrels and Cisterns
Collecting rainwater in barrels or cisterns is a simple and cost-effective way to conserve water and reduce stormwater runoff. You can use the collected water for irrigation, washing cars, or even flushing toilets.
- Cost: $100-$500 (depending on size and material)
- Maintenance: Regularly inspect and clean the system
French Drains and Swales
French drains and swales are designed to direct rainwater away from your home and yard. These systems typically involve a network of pipes and trenches that channel water into a drainage system or a natural watercourse.
- Cost: $1,000-$5,000 (depending on size and complexity)
- Maintenance: Regularly inspect and clean the system
Permeable Pavers and Porous Surfaces
Permeable pavers and porous surfaces allow rainwater to seep into the ground, reducing stormwater runoff. These materials are perfect for patios, walkways, and driveways.
- Cost: $5-$15 per square foot (depending on material)
- Maintenance: Regularly inspect and clean the surface
Seasonal Tips for Effective Drainage on Marco Island
To ensure your drainage system functions optimally throughout the year, follow these seasonal tips:
Spring (March to May)
- Inspect and clean your rain barrels and cisterns
- Check for any blockages in your French drains or swales
- Apply mulch or compost to improve soil structure and water retention
Summer (June to August)
- Monitor your yard's drainage system during heavy rainfall events
- Ensure your gutters and downspouts are clear of debris
- Consider installing a rain sensor to regulate irrigation systems
Fall (September to November)
- Clean and inspect your permeable pavers and porous surfaces
- Check for any signs of erosion or damage to plants
- Apply a soil conditioner to improve water retention and fertility
